JDO-751 "Support for Java8 Optional" https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/JDO-751 Discussed use of “naked” Optional as a field type. Probably could support this but would need extra metadata in the .jdo file or annotations. Also could support Optional<Object> in the same way. It looks like we currently have no negative test cases for enhancement that would catch e.g. Optional<Optional<T>>. 3.
